Transponder Codes

When a transponder gets interrogated, it sends an encoded signal that is accompanied by an eight-digit code. This signal, referred to as SQUAWK Code SQUAWK Code is used to locate aircraft on radar screens. It can also be used to transmit a specific message to the air traffic control system in the event of an emergency or to notify controllers to changes in weather conditions. Squawk codes are frequently used to communicate with ATC in situations where the pilot is unable to talk on the radio and are crucial for safe flying.

Each aircraft has a transponder, which responds to radar interrogation by displaying an identifier. This allows ATC to locate the aircraft on a radar screen that is busy. Transponders come in a variety of modes that vary in how they respond to interrogation. Mode A only transmits the code and mode C provides information about altitude. Mode S transponders offer more details like call signs and position that can be helpful in airspace that is congested.

The majority of aircraft have a small, beige box under the seat of the pilot. This is the transponder. it is set up to transmit an SQUAWK code whenever the airplane is activated by air traffic control. The transponder can be set to the ON position, ALT position, or SBY (standby) position.

It is common to hear pilots being told by air traffic control to "squawk ident". This is an instruction for pilots to press their transponder IDENT button. The ident button causes the aircraft blink on ATC radar screens which allows them to identify your aircraft on the screen.

PIN Codes

A PIN code consists of a sequence of numbers (usually 4 or 6 digits), which are used to gain access to a device, service, or system. For instance, a smart phone, for instance, has a PIN that the user must enter every time they use the device. PIN codes are also used to safeguard ATM or POS transactions,[1] secure access control (doors, computers, cars),[2] computer systems,[3] and internet transactions.

Even though a longer password may seem more secure than a smaller one, it's possible to hack or guess the 4-digit PIN. To ensure greater security, it is recommended that PINs are at least 6 digits long, and include both numbers and letters. VIN Numbers

VIN numbers are used to identify vehicles and provide an abundance of information about them. VIN numbers are unique to every vehicle on earth, except for alien cars (or whatever). The 17 digits that make up the VIN code contain an array of letters and numbers that can be decoded to reveal vital information about your vehicle or truck.

Modern cars are loaded with a vast amount of data about their history and specs and functions as digital libraries on the move. The key to unlocking this information is the VIN number. This lets you determine everything from if your car was involved in a recall, to how many owners it's had.

Each VIN number contains a different piece of information. The first digit is for instance, what type of car it is, such as a pickup truck, or SUV. The second digit is the manufacturer. The third digit is the car's assembly division. The fourth through eighth digits indicate the model type, restraint systems type and body type, as well as the transmission and engine codes. The ninth digit acts as a check number to ensure that there is no fraud. It ensures that the VIN has not been altered.

In North America, 10th through 17th numbers of the VIN are referred to as the Vehicle Identification Section (VIS). The tenth digit is the year of the vehicle's production, and the eleventh digit shows which assembly plant produced the vehicle. The digits from tenth to 17th may also contain additional information, such as features or options that are installed in the vehicle.
